Go with the Lund remote tune . They know forced induction . A few pulls at WOT and you're done . All you need is the tuner and a computer to data log . Plus the customer service is great , the guys at lund have always got back with me when I had a question . Only problem is they only do business through there website via email so you would have to make an account . They don't do phone calls

It is a pretty neat process. When you start with the WOT logs the tune will be really rich and very conservative on the timing just to make sure the car is responding like it should. Then they'll start to lean it out and add timing. It's neat to feel the difference a couple degrees of timing makes
